Troubleshooting Common Mini Split Line Set Problems

Mini split systems can deliver efficient and comfortable climate control, but sometimes problems with the line set can arise. A line set is a vital component that conducts refrigerant between the indoor and outdoor units. When this system fails, it can result in reduced cooling capacity, unit failures, or even leaks.

Several common issues can develop with mini split line sets. One frequent problem is contamination, which can block refrigerant flow. This may result inadequate cooling or no cooling at all. Another common issue is incorrect line length, which can affect the system's efficiency and performance.

Inspecting the line set for any visible damage, such as abrasions, is crucial. Additionally, verify that all connections are secured properly to prevent leaks. If you observe a problem with your mini split line set, it's best to call a qualified HVAC technician for diagnosis.
